Minecraft Bedrock

The Bedrock edition is the most modern version of Minecraft, available on consoles, tablets, and PC. Launched in 2011 and officially in 2016, this version has some key differences with the Java edition, especially in terms of customization and server control. πŸ› οΈ

  • Multi-platform accessibility: You can play on Nintendo Switch, Xbox, PlayStation, and mobile devices. 🌐

skins

  • 3D Skins: Forget about flat textures! Customize your character with 3D skins directly from the Bedrock client. πŸ‘Ύ

minijuegos

  • Official Addons: Buy and use addons from the marketplace to add new game modes, maps, and more. πŸ’Έ

trofeos

  • Achievements and Trophies: Includes an integrated achievement system that allows players to unlock trophies and rewards within the game.

  • Performance and customization: There's less control over the server and modifications compared to Java. πŸ› οΈπŸ§©
  • Restricted multiplayer: Fewer servers available, but you can create your own to play with friends.
  • Optimization: Although Bedrock is designed to run well on a variety of devices, performance can be inconsistent, especially on servers with many players or in very large worlds.
  • Overload Issues: Performance can be affected if there are too many players, entities, or active addons.
  • Closed Ecosystem: Although Bedrock allows cross-platform play, some features and modifications available in Java are not available in Bedrock.
  • Java Exclusive Features: Some features and updates may be available first on Java, and some advanced functionalities might not be present in Bedrock.
  • Content Delay: Sometimes, updates or new content can arrive on Bedrock with a delay compared to Java.
